Talk | A talk or slide show presentation.Educational | A trip where the leader will focus on teaching or training.Social | A trip where people will be encouraged to interact and chat with each other.Raising the Warragamba Dam wall would destroy 65km of wilderness Rivers and inundate 4,700 hectares of the world heritage listed Blue Mountains National Park. There is a very real threat that raising the Warragamba Dam wall may result in the de-listing of the Greater Blue Mountains from the UNESCO World Heritage List. GIVE A DAM is the grassroots community campaign to stop the destruction of the Blue Mountains national park and the over development in western Sydney from the raising of Warragamba Dam wall. This documentary showcases the spectacular landscapes under threat and the people who are trying to save it. View
